Solution Overview
Problem
Traditional gaming systems offer a one-size-fits-all approach to wagering options, failing to accommodate the varying wagering habits and risk tolerances of different players, leading to an inconsistent gaming experience for remote players participating in physical gaming table games.
Innovation Solution
A gaming system that allows for customizable wagering options by analyzing player data and characteristics, enabling remote players to access different wagering configurations and game features based on their individual profiles, while maintaining static parameters for physical players at the table.

Engineering Contradiction Analysis
1Adaptability or versatility
If a one-size-fits-all wagering approach is used for all players at a physical gaming table, then the system is simple to operate and maintain, but it fails to accommodate varying wagering habits and risk tolerances of different players
Solution Approach 1:
The system segments the gaming experience by creating separate parameter sets for different players. Each player has their own profile with customized wagering limits, game features, and risk parameters that are independently managed. This allows the system to accommodate varying wagering habits without requiring a complete system overhaul.
Solution Approach 2:
The patent applies local quality by allowing different portions of the gaming system to have different parameters tailored to specific players. Instead of uniform system-wide settings, each player interacts with customized local parameters including wagering limits, game features, and risk thresholds that match their individual preferences and risk tolerance.
2Ease of operation
If player-specific virtual gaming tables with customized parameters are implemented, then personalized gaming experience is improved, but the device complexity and data management requirements increase
Solution Approach 1:
The system creates virtual copies of gaming tables with customized parameters for each player. Instead of modifying the physical table itself, the system generates digital replicas that mirror the physical table's functionality while incorporating player-specific adaptations. This allows personalized experiences without physically altering the base gaming infrastructure.
Solution Approach 2:
The system performs preliminary actions by pre-configuring player profiles with customized parameters before the player begins gaming. Wagering limits, risk thresholds, and preferred game features are established in advance based on player characteristics and preferences, eliminating the need for real-time adjustments during gameplay.
3Productivity
If remote players are given access to physical gaming tables with customized parameters, then player engagement is enhanced, but the system requires more sophisticated data processing and communication infrastructure
Solution Approach 1:
The system introduces an intermediary layer between remote players and physical gaming tables. This intermediary component manages the complex data processing, parameter customization, and communication protocols, shielding remote players from infrastructure complexity while enabling enhanced engagement through personalized virtual table access.
